본문 바로가기
MySql

MySQL CF10, MYSQL SQL_SELECT_LIMIT = DEFAULT

by 베이스 공부 2021. 1. 11.
반응형

방금 mysql 5.6으로 CF10, win2008, IIS 7.5를 설정했습니다. 그러나 다음과 같은 오류가 발생합니다.

Error Executing Database Query.
You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'OPTION SQL_SELECT_LIMIT=DEFAULT

이 오류는 쿼리에 "LIMIT"를 명시 적으로 설정하면 제거됩니다.

(댓글 업데이트)

다음은 예입니다.

<cfquery name="dds" datasource ="#Request.Datasource#"> 
    SELECT * 
    FROM   tblaccounts 
    LIMIT 100 
</cfquery> 

내 연구에 따르면 새로운 버전의 mysql 5.6과 호환되지 않습니다.

 

해결 방법

 

위의 답변에서 더 자세한 내용을 빌리십시오.


Windows 시스템에서 JDBC 커넥터를 업데이트하려면


새 .jar가 ColdFusion에서 인식되었는지 확인하려면 ColdFusion 관리자에 로그인하고 "서버 설정"에서 "설정 요약"을 클릭합니다. "mysql"을 검색합니다. "CF 서버 Java 클래스 경로"섹션 아래에 나열된 .jar 파일이 표시되어야합니다. 데이터 소스를 다시 설정할 필요가 없습니다. 이러한 변경 사항은 자동으로 적용됩니다.

 

참조 페이지 https://stackoverflow.com/questions/15038312

 

 

반응형

댓글